Evaluate for Entrance Details



To begin rodent-proofing your attic, inspect for entry points. Beginning by meticulously examining the outside of your home, searching for any type of openings that rats could make use of to gain access to your attic. Ensure to pay attention to areas where various structure products meet, as these prevail entry points for rodents.

In addition, examine the roofing for any kind of harmed or missing out on roof shingles, along with any type of spaces around the edges where rodents can press via. Inside the attic room, look for indicators of existing rodent task such as droppings, ate cables, or nesting products. Utilize a flashlight to extensively check dark corners and surprise rooms.

Seal Cracks and Gaps



Inspect your attic room completely for any cracks and voids that need to be secured to avoid rodents from going into. Rats can squeeze via even the tiniest openings, so it's important to secure any potential access factors. Inspect around pipelines, vents, cables, and where the walls fulfill the roofing. Make use of a combination of steel wool and caulking to seal off these openings effectively. Steel wool is an exceptional deterrent as rats can not chew via it. Get Rid Of Food Sources



Take proactive actions to remove or keep all potential food sources in your attic room to discourage rats from infesting the space. Rats are drawn in to food, so eliminating their food resources is important in keeping them out of your attic.

Below's what you can do:

1. ** Shop food firmly **: Prevent leaving any type of food things in the attic room. Shop all food in closed containers made from metal or durable plastic to avoid rodents from accessing them.

2. ** Clean up particles **: Remove any kind of heaps of particles, such as old newspapers, cardboard boxes, or wood scraps, that rodents can use as nesting material or food resources. Keep the attic room clutter-free to make it much less attractive to rodents.

3. ** Dispose of garbage effectively **: If you use your attic room for storage space and have garbage or waste up there, ensure to throw away it regularly and correctly. Rotting trash bin draw in rodents, so maintain the attic room tidy and devoid of any type of organic waste.
